Transaction 835515b35c8af12fd466fa60a703d28c64e53824b20dea1d4ad471c76cafd2cd
1 Input
1 Output
-
835515b35c8af12fd466fa60a703d28c64e53824b20dea1d4ad471c76cafd2cd:0
- value
- 197727253
- script pubkey
- OP_0 OP_PUSHBYTES_20 3de31c1709cf4e39b3eee19c0a56aa6b5fa264cb
- address
- bc1q8h33c9cfea8rnvlwuxwq5442dd06yextehf0p7